#ifndef _PATHUT_H_INCLUDED_
|
|
#define _PATHUT_H_INCLUDED_
|
|
|
|
#include <string>
|
|
#include <vector>
|
|
#include <set>
|
|
|
|
// Must be called in main thread before starting other threads
|
|
extern void pathut_init_mt();
|
|
|
|
/// Add a / at the end if none there yet.
|
|
extern void path_catslash(std::string& s);
|
|
/// Concatenate 2 paths
|
|
extern std::string path_cat(const std::string& s1, const std::string& s2);
|
|
/// Get the simple file name (get rid of any directory path prefix
|
|
extern std::string path_getsimple(const std::string& s);
|
|
/// Simple file name + optional suffix stripping
|
|
extern std::string path_basename(const std::string& s,
|
|
const std::string& suff = std::string());
|
|
/// Component after last '.'
|
|
extern std::string path_suffix(const std::string& s);
|
|
/// Get the father directory
|
|
extern std::string path_getfather(const std::string& s);
|
|
/// Get the current user's home directory
|
|
extern std::string path_home();
|
|
/// Expand ~ at the beginning of std::string
|
|
extern std::string path_tildexpand(const std::string& s);
|
|
/// Use getcwd() to make absolute path if needed. Beware: ***this can fail***
|
|
/// we return an empty path in this case.
|
|
extern std::string path_absolute(const std::string& s);
|
|
/// Clean up path by removing duplicated / and resolving ../ + make it absolute
|
|
extern std::string path_canon(const std::string& s, const std::string *cwd = 0);
|
|
/// Use glob(3) to return the file names matching pattern inside dir
|
|
extern std::vector<std::string> path_dirglob(const std::string& dir,
|
|
const std::string pattern);
|
|
/// Encode according to rfc 1738
|
|
extern std::string url_encode(const std::string& url,
|
|
std::string::size_type offs = 0);
|
|
extern std::string url_decode(const std::string& encoded);
|
|
//// Convert to file path if url is like file://. This modifies the
|
|
//// input (and returns a copy for convenience)
|
|
extern std::string fileurltolocalpath(std::string url);
|
|
/// Test for file:/// url
|
|
extern bool urlisfileurl(const std::string& url);
|
|
///
|
|
extern std::string url_parentfolder(const std::string& url);
|
|
|
|
/// Return the host+path part of an url. This is not a general
|
|
/// routine, it does the right thing only in the recoll context
|
|
extern std::string url_gpath(const std::string& url);
|
|
|
|
/// Stat parameter and check if it's a directory
|
|
extern bool path_isdir(const std::string& path);
|
|
|
|
/// Retrieve file size
|
|
extern long long path_filesize(const std::string& path);
|
|
|
|
/// Retrieve essential file attributes. This is used rather than a
|
|
/// bare stat() to ensure consistent use of the time fields (on
|
|
/// windows, we set ctime=mtime as ctime is actually the creation
|
|
/// time, for which we have no use).
|
|
/// Only st_mtime, st_ctime, st_size, st_mode (file type bits) are set on
|
|
/// all systems. st_dev and st_ino are set for special posix usage.
|
|
/// The rest is zeroed.
|
|
/// @ret 0 for success
|
|
struct stat;
|
|
extern int path_fileprops(const std::string path, struct stat *stp,
|
|
bool follow = true);
|
|
|
|
/// Check that path is traversable and last element exists
|
|
/// Returns true if last elt could be checked to exist. False may mean that
|
|
/// the file/dir does not exist or that an error occurred.
|
|
extern bool path_exists(const std::string& path);
|
|
|
|
/// Return separator for PATH environment variable
|
|
extern std::string path_PATHsep();
|
|
|
|
#ifdef _WIN32
|
|
#define SYSPATH(PATH, SPATH) wchar_t PATH ## _buf[2048]; \
|
|
utf8towchar(PATH, PATH ## _buf, 2048); \
|
|
wchar_t *SPATH = PATH ## _buf;
|
|
#else
|
|
#define SYSPATH(PATH, SPATH) const char *SPATH = PATH.c_str()
|
|
#endif
|
|
|
|
/// Dump directory
|
|
extern bool readdir(const std::string& dir, std::string& reason,
|
|
std::set<std::string>& entries);
|
|
|
|
/** A small wrapper around statfs et al, to return percentage of disk
|
|
occupation
|
|
@param[output] pc percent occupied
|
|
@param[output] avmbs Mbs available to non-superuser. Mb=1024*1024
|
|
*/
|
|
bool fsocc(const std::string& path, int *pc, long long *avmbs = 0);
|
|
|
|
/// mkdir -p
|
|
extern bool path_makepath(const std::string& path, int mode);
|
|
|
|
/// Where we create the user data subdirs
|
|
extern std::string path_homedata();
|
|
/// Test if path is absolute
|
|
extern bool path_isabsolute(const std::string& s);
|
|
|
|
/// Test if path is root (x:/). root is defined by root/.. == root
|
|
extern bool path_isroot(const std::string& p);
|
|
|
|
/// Test if sub is a subdirectory of top. This is a textual test,
|
|
/// links not allowed
|
|
extern bool path_isdesc(const std::string& top, const std::string& sub);
|
|
|
|
/// Turn absolute path into file:// url
|
|
extern std::string path_pathtofileurl(const std::string& path);
|
|
|
|
/// URI parser, loosely from rfc2396.txt
|
|
class ParsedUri {
|
|
public:
|
|
ParsedUri(std::string uri);
|
|
bool parsed{false};
|
|
std::string scheme;
|
|
std::string user;
|
|
std::string pass;
|
|
std::string host;
|
|
std::string port;
|
|
std::string path;
|
|
std::string query;
|
|
std::vector<std::pair<std::string,std::string>> parsedquery;
|
|
std::string fragment;
|
|
};
|
|
|
|
#ifdef _WIN32
|
|
/// Convert \ separators to /
|
|
void path_slashize(std::string& s);
|
|
void path_backslashize(std::string& s);
|
|
#endif
|
|
|
|
/// Lock/pid file class. This is quite close to the pidfile_xxx
|
|
/// utilities in FreeBSD with a bit more encapsulation. I'd have used
|
|
/// the freebsd code if it was available elsewhere
|
|
class Pidfile {
|
|
public:
|
|
Pidfile(const std::string& path) : m_path(path), m_fd(-1) {}
|
|
~Pidfile();
|
|
/// Open/create the pid file.
|
|
/// @return 0 if ok, > 0 for pid of existing process, -1 for other error.
|
|
pid_t open();
|
|
/// Write pid into the pid file
|
|
/// @return 0 ok, -1 error
|
|
int write_pid();
|
|
/// Close the pid file (unlocks)
|
|
int close();
|
|
/// Delete the pid file
|
|
int remove();
|
|
const std::string& getreason() {
|
|
return m_reason;
|
|
}
|
|
private:
|
|
std::string m_path;
|
|
int m_fd;
|
|
std::string m_reason;
|
|
pid_t read_pid();
|
|
int flopen();
|
|
};
|
|
|
|
#endif /* _PATHUT_H_INCLUDED_ */
